It’s a supplement designed to inhibit enzymes from breaking down carbs so that they pass through undigested. All the fun of eating carbs without the calories essentially,
May cause terrible gas and diarrhea.

I guess I'm confused a bit because numerically you fall almost entirely in line with normal values for muscle mass. Your body fat percentage (25%) would put you into the American College of Sports Medicine fitness category of poor. Your squat falls just inside the Advanced category on absolute weight but below optimal for relative weight (1.5x BW) which would be 334#. Your bench falls into the decent to good absolute side but below decent relatively at 67% of BW.
However, all of that aside, what is your point with this? - What are your prescriptions for? Weight loss? - What are your personal health goals? Lose weight or simply be in a good level of cardiovascular fitness?
Because ultimately the heart has to push against the weight of whatever mass you've cultivated. Significantly above average muscle mass can be as detrimental as significantly above average fat deposition. One is just MORE commonly associated with heart issues since it is so much more prevalent in our society than the much more difficult to achieve other.
Are you slightly overweight at your height? Yea maybe. Are you morbidly obese or anything? No. Your BMI falls within overweight but not obese from a technical standpoint.
The best exercise for your body height/weight is probably the fork put down at the moment or changing your macro balance. I just feel like there is something missing here. I don't think many PCP's would jump to prescribing weight loss meds at this range unless there was something else to it OR the meds aren't for weight loss. I believe the differentiation of MAC from simple sedation is primarily related to the staff. MAC requires a trained anesthesia provider to be doing the work vs. a procedural sedation performed by an assisting nurse or the operating doctor.
